The claim file should be supported by and contain meaningful documentation: Report only the facts. Report all meaningful facts. Have photographs of overviews and closeups, including damage and undamaged areas. Retain all important documents. Retain all documents provided by the insured.
Steps for filing an auto insurance claim Location, date, and time of accident. Name, address, phone number, and insurance policy number for all involved in the accident. Weather conditions. Photo(s) of the damaged vehicle(s) Copies of the police and/or accident reports, if applicable.
Admitting fault: Using apologetic language is enough for the insurance adjuster to assume you're admitting fault and use that against you. Even if you feel you're at fault, wait for the official investigation to prove what actually happened. Don't say things like ?I'm sorry? or ?it was my fault.?
